Ableton Note

Key Features

Ableton Note is designed for music creators who seek simplicity without sacrificing functionality. One key characteristic of this app is its streamlined user interface, which makes navigation intuitive even for beginners. It offers unique features like MIDI clip creation, allowing users to make musical ideas quickly. This functionality is a significant advantage for those who want to focus on composition rather than technical setup.

A noteworthy aspect of Ableton Note is its integration with Ableton Live on desktops, providing a seamless transition from mobile to studio environments. However, some users may find the limited sound library compared to full desktop versions a constraint, particularly if they are looking for diverse sound options.

Use Cases

The use cases for Ableton Note are diverse, catering to both quick idea sketches and more detailed projects. Itโ€™s particularly beneficial for songwriters who wish to capture inspiration on the go. The app allows users to record audio and take notes, making it suitable for multiple creative processes.

While its mobile-first approach provides flexibility, some musicians may prefer more advanced features available in desktop software. However, Ableton Note serves as an ideal resource for those starting their journey in music production.

FL Studio Mobile

User Interface

FL Studio Mobile features a user interface that reflects its desktop heritage. The interface is comprehensive, offering a range of tools for mixing and editing. This key characteristic is significant because it allows users familiar with the desktop version to adapt quickly.

Moreover, its layout facilitates multitouch functionality, allowing for various simultaneous operations, which can speed up the production process. However, some users report that the learning curve may be steeper than with simpler apps, potentially intimidating newcomers.

Audio Recording Capabilities

The audio recording capabilities of FL Studio Mobile stand out due to its high-quality input options. The app supports recording multiple audio tracks, enabling layering and more complex arrangements. This feature is beneficial for musicians who require detailed control over their recordings.

The unique ability to export projects to the desktop version of FL Studio allows for further refinement, making it an edge for those working across platforms. Nonetheless, users might find the initial setup for recording to be somewhat intricate without prior experience.

BandLab

Collaborative Features

BandLab shines in its collaborative features, allowing musicians to work together in real-time. This capability is crucial for modern music creators, as it promotes teamwork and collective feedback. Users can invite others to join projects, making it easy to share ideas and refine sound.

This app's unique ability to enable asynchronous collaboration is a notable advantage. Musicians can leave comments and suggestions, enhancing the creative process. However, online collaboration may be hindered by connectivity issues or latency, which some users might find frustrating.

Cloud Integration

The cloud integration in BandLab is another important aspect. This functionality means that users can access their projects from any device, providing flexibility that traditional software cannot match. It allows for seamless transitions between devices, promoting a more integrated workflow.

One possible downside is the dependency on internet connectivity for syncing. If users do not have reliable access, they could face challenges in retrieving or saving their work. Overall, the convenience of being able to access projects online is a powerful feature that supports mobile music creation.

Caustic

Sound Synthesis Options

Caustic 3 is recognized for its robust sound synthesis capabilities. The app offers various subsystems for generating sounds, including subsynth and pcm synth, catering to sound designers and electronic music enthusiasts. This aspect is a key characteristic as it allows a high degree of customization and creativity within the app.

The unique feature of allowing multiple machines to operate simultaneously is beneficial for creating rich soundscapes. However, it may require a more knowledgeable user to exploit these features fully, which could be seen as a disadvantage for beginners.

Pattern-Based Workflow

The pattern-based workflow in Caustic 3 is integral to its operational approach. Users can create patterns that can be easily arranged and modified, which is a distinct advantage for those who prefer structured production methods. This methodology is beneficial for maintaining organization in complex projects.

However, some users might find this workflow less intuitive if they prefer a freeform approach to music creation. The learning process can be intensive but rewarding for those who invest time in mastering the system.

Minimum Device Specifications

The minimum device specifications refer to the basic hardware and software needs that a music creation app must have. Each app has its own set of requirements, usually listed in the app store description. Generally, essential aspects include the device's processor speed, RAM, and storage capacity.

For example, a device with at least 2GB of RAM may be required for running more complex music apps. Insufficienct RAM could lead to lagging or crashing during music production. Additionally, a multi-core processor is often recommended for smooth performance, especially when handling multiple tracks and effects.

โ€ข Processor: 2 GHz multi-core processor recommended. โ€ข RAM: Minimum of 2 GB. โ€ข Storage: At least 500 MB of free space for the app and additional space for sound packs.

Having these specifications ensures that users can explore the appโ€™s extensive features without interruptions, allowing them to fully engage in the creative process.

OS Compatibility

OS compatibility is another vital aspect to consider when selecting music creation apps. Android updates frequently, bringing new features and enhancing security. Therefore, ensuring that the app is compatible with your deviceโ€™s operating system version is necessary.

Many developers optimize apps for the latest versions of Android, leaving older systems unsupported. This could jeopardize performance for users on outdated devices. Users should check for compatibility information provided in the app's store listing.

Incompatibility may result in the app failing to install or operate correctly, hindering the music production workflow. To enjoy new features and improved stability:

โ€ข Update your Android OS regularly. โ€ข Check the app requirements before installation.

For those producing music, ensuring a compatible device not only enhances usability but also extends the app's life cycle with software updates. In this rapidly evolving field of music creation, staying up to date is essential for the best experience.

Connecting to Devices

MIDI (Musical Instrument Digital Interface) devices have been a staple in music production for decades. They allow musicians to control hardware and software instruments through a standardized protocol. Connecting to MIDI devices offers various benefits, such as:

  • Enhanced Creativity: MIDI controllers, like keyboards or pads, enable performers to create intricate melodies and beats with ease. This hands-on approach fosters creativity.
  • Real-time Performance: Performing live or in the studio becomes more intuitive with MIDI devices, which react to the expressiveness of a musicianโ€™s touch.
  • Automation and Control: MIDI enables control over playback, such as adjusting volume levels and applying effects in real-time.

To connect MIDI devices to Android apps, you typically need an OTG (On-The-Go) cable. This allows USB MIDI devices to communicate with mobile applications easily. Many popular DAWs, such as FL Studio Mobile, support MIDI integration, meaning users can seamlessly connect and utilize their MIDI gear.

Using Audio Interfaces

Audio interfaces serve as a bridge between analog and digital sound. They improve the audio quality of recordings and playback, making them invaluable tools in music production. Benefits of using an audio interface include:

  • Superior Sound Quality: Audio interfaces typically have better DACs (Digital to Analog Converters) compared to mobile device inputs, ensuring a clearer and more accurate representation of sound.
  • Multiple Inputs and Outputs: Many audio interfaces offer multiple inputs, allowing you to record several instruments simultaneously. This is particularly useful for band recordings or layered compositions.
  • Low Latency Monitoring: With an audio interface, the delay between input and output is significantly reduced. This low latency is critical in live performances and recording scenarios.

Connecting an audio interface to an Android device may require a compatible OTG cable. Many apps support USB audio input, enabling users to enhance their recording capabilities. However, it's essential to check the appโ€™s compatibility with specific audio interfaces before making a purchase.

Processing Power Constraints

One of the most significant challenges in mobile music production is the processing power of devices. Most Android smartphones and tablets do not have the same capabilities as desktop computers. Consequently, users may experience issues such as lag or crashes when using resource-intensive applications.

The processing limitations can result in delayed audio playback, especially when working with multiple tracks or using complex plugins. This can be frustrating, as artists often rely on real-time feedback while creating their music. To mitigate these issues, users should consider the following:

  • Optimal App Selection: Choose apps that are optimized for mobile devices, like FL Studio Mobile or BandLab, which have lighter interfaces.
  • Track Limitation: Limit the number of tracks used in a single project to reduce the demand on system resources.
  • Sticking to Audio: Sometimes, it is better to use audio clips instead of MIDI for more complex arrangements. This reduces the processing load significantly.

Managing Storage Space

Storage space is another notable limitation when producing music on an Android device. High-quality audio files, samples, and extensive libraries can quickly consume a significant amount of storage. Users must be vigilant about managing their storage to avoid running into problems that could halt the creative process.

To effectively manage storage space, consider the following tips:

  • Regular Cleanup: Periodically delete unused files or old projects to free up space.
  • External Storage Solutions: Utilize microSD cards to expand storage capacity for music projects, allowing for more flexibility in saving samples and recordings.
  • Cloud-Based Solutions: Leverage apps like BandLab, which offer cloud storage, ensuring space on your device is available for other essential applications or files.
